VBS 代码:将文件夹内文件更新到另一个文件夹
以下是将文件夹内的文件更新到另一个文件夹的 VBS 代码示例:\n\nvbscript\nDim objFSO, objFolder, objFiles, objFile\nDim sourceFolder, destinationFolder\n\n' 源文件夹路径\nsourceFolder = "D:\Desktop\DM\aaa"\n' 目标文件夹路径\ndestinationFolder = "D:\Desktop\DM\bbb"\n\n' 创建文件系统对象\nSet objFSO = CreateObject("Scripting.FileSystemObject")\n\n' 获取源文件夹对象\nSet objFolder = objFSO.GetFolder(sourceFolder)\n' 获取源文件夹中的所有文件对象\nSet objFiles = objFolder.Files\n\n' 遍历源文件夹中的所有文件\nFor Each objFile In objFiles\n ' 获取文件名\n fileName = objFSO.GetFileName(objFile)\n ' 构建目标文件路径\n destinationPath = objFSO.BuildPath(destinationFolder, fileName)\n \n ' 判断目标文件是否已存在\n If objFSO.FileExists(destinationPath) Then\n ' 如果目标文件已存在,则删除目标文件\n objFSO.DeleteFile(destinationPath)\n End If\n \n ' 将源文件复制到目标文件夹中\n objFSO.CopyFile objFile.Path, destinationPath\nNext\n\n' 释放对象\nSet objFSO = Nothing\nSet objFolder = Nothing\nSet objFiles = Nothing\nSet objFile = Nothing\n\n\n请确保替换 sourceFolder 和 destinationFolder 变量的值为实际的文件夹路径。此代码将遍历源文件夹中的所有文件,并将每个文件复制到目标文件夹中。如果目标文件夹中已存在同名文件,则会先删除目标文件,然后再将源文件复制到目标文件夹。
原文地址: https://www.cveoy.top/t/topic/p1uJ 著作权归作者所有。请勿转载和采集!